Potato Pancakes

By admin | October 10, 2009

5 potatoes, peeled and shredded

2 eggs, beaten

1 onion, finely chopped

3 tablespoons all purpose flour

salt and pepper to your taste

3 tablespoons vegetable oil

Combine the batter into a large bowl, mixing the potatoes, eggs, onion, all purpose flour, salt and pepper, and the vegetable oil. Mix until you have a well mixed batter, and make sure it is all stirred in evenly. Using a spoon, pour spoonfuls of batter onto a hot skillet or flat pan. Flatten with a spatula, and cook until the sides are browned. When they are browned, then flip to bake other side. The perfect potato pancakes for any occasion!
